Job Requirements
Job benefits
-
Free food & beverages
Avoid wasting time and energy to buy food at the restaurant or hawker center by yourself. We'll provide the best food for you and your team. Make better use of your valuable time to rest, bond, and do other things that matter to you.
-
Medical insurance
To ensure your health and wellbeing, you have various medical plans to choose from depending on your situation and unique needs. From partial up to full medical coverage, we got you covered.
-
Team-building events
Our company simply cannot function well without teams of people working together. That said, we provide numerous team-building activities and events for you and your team to nurture meaningful relationships between every individual.
-
Professional Development
Every employee is an invaluable asset to any team; that's why we want to help you grow. Level up your skills and expertise through our professional co-development programs with notable organizations. We will cover the cost.
This job post is managed by
Skills
Job description for PHP Developer (Symfony/ Laravel) at Ekino Vietnam
- Participate in cutting-edge digital project development for worldwide leading companies on various business domains.
- Analyze requirements, come up with adequate technical design and maintain technical documentation
- Write clean and maintainable code using engineering best practices (unit testing, continuous integration, design patterns, devops, etc.). Comply with the coding standards (SDLC guidelines) - Unit Tests;
- Participate in and may conduct code reviews. Follow, improve and enforce coding standards
- Write unit tests and interact regularly with testers to prevent regression issues
- Provide estimates for development effort
- Actively raise early any concerns to Tech lead / Project Manager and suggest action plan to improve overall quality
- Research new technologies and existing libraries
- Partner with Technical Project Managers to share knowledge to other team members, make the most of knowledge built by other team members
- Troubleshoot performance, scale, object clustering issue for integration solutions and debugging.
- Team management: assist junior members with design challenges and coding issues; evaluate their performance on a defined period.
- 3+ years of experience in web development technologies & have in-depth knowledge of PHP and OOP
- Experience in architecture patterns, coding conventions & best practices
- Solid knowledge in common web-based application and web technology concepts (CMS, Portal, SEO, ORM, Social network integration, RESTful etc)
- Experience in open-source frameworks: Symfony, Doctrine, Laravel, Zend, Yii; and CMS Drupal, Wordpress
- Experience with deployment process and platforms: Nginx, Apache, Capistrano, Varnish, Memcached, Redis, Vagrant.
- DevOps, using Puppet, Docker as provisioning
- Good knowledge in relational DBMS e.g MySQL, Postgres, etc.Knowledge/ Experience in NoSQL DBMS (MongoDB, CouchDB ...)
- Familiar with source control management: git and gitflow
- Familiar with bug tracking systems: Jira / Redmine / Mantis
- Experience in web security
- Strong leadership, collaboration, presentation skills, ability to think creatively, strategically and act tactically
- Good communication in English
- Knowledge of front-end development: HTML, CSS, JS, TWBootstrap, JQuery is an advantage
- High-ownership working environment: You will take full responsibility and control of your missions contributing to the team’s success
- Continuous skill improvement with new technologies, challenging projects, on-the-job coaching, and training programs
- Annual performance review: recognize your efforts and identify development/ improvement needs
- Clear career path: define your career development with long-term vision
- Be secured in your mind with employee’s care: private healthcare insurance package, medical check-up, lunch support...
- Great-place-to-work activities (company trip, sport clubs...): enhance teamwork spirit and facilitate your work-life harmony
- Opportunity to work in France upon project and mission requirements
Glints Safety Tips
Don't provide your bank or credit card details when applying for jobs. Legitimate employers and hiring managers do not require an application fee or expect you to pay for training.
Learn More